In the treatment of acute myeloid leukemia (AML), h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) procedure is employed. It involves the infusion of healthy blood-forming stem cells from a donor into the body of the patient to initiate production of healthy blood cells after the hematopoietic function of the bone marrow of the patient has been destroyed by chemotherapy and radiation.
Before the stem transplant, the patient is subjected to a conditioning process or therapy, which involves undergoing a treatment through chemotherapy and radiation therapy. <em>The main purpose of these therapies are to suppress the immune system and destroy cancer cells of the blood by destroying the ability of the body to produce blood cells inside the bone marrow in preparation of the bone marrow for the new stem cells from the donor.
</em>
After these therapies, the transplant infusion takes place, which is usually painless.

<span>mRNA capping is the posttrancriptional modification of messenger RNA when the nucleotide on the 5′ end is specially altered. The process is highly regulated and it creates stable and mature messenger RNA able to undergo translation. The cap on the <span>5’ end of mRNA consists of a guanine nucleotide connected to mRNA via an unusual 5′ to 5′ triphosphate linkage. Guanosine is methylated on the position 7 after capping.</span></span>
